Maximizing Your Software Development Potential: A Guide to Transforming Ideas into Actionable Solutions, with RG Infosys
From Concept to Creation: Let RG Infosys Be Your Guide
Contact: https://forms.gle/7DqZiVNS7Xa5Z3b87
In today's digital age, ideas are increasingly being transformed into software. With the rise of software development tools and platforms, it has become easier than ever before to turn an idea into a functioning software application. However, the process of transforming an idea into software is not a straightforward one, and involves several steps that must be carefully managed in order to achieve success. In this article, we will explore the various steps involved in the transformation of ideas into software.
Step 1: Ideation
The first step in transforming an idea into software is ideation. This is the stage where the idea is conceptualized, and the basic features and functionality of the software are defined. During this stage, it is important to clearly define the problem that the software is intended to solve, as well as the target audience and their needs.
Step 2: Requirements Gathering
Once the basic idea has been established, the next step is to gather requirements. This involves defining the specific features and functionality that the software will need in order to solve the problem identified in the ideation phase. Requirements gathering typically involves brainstorming sessions, interviews with stakeholders, and market research.
Step 3: Design
Once the requirements have been gathered, the next step is to design the software. This involves creating a detailed plan for the architecture, user interface, and other key components of the software. During this stage, it is important to consider factors such as scalability, security, and usability.
Step 4: Development
Once the design has been finalized, the next step is development. This involves writing the code for the software application, and testing it to ensure that it functions as intended. Development typically involves several stages, including coding, testing, debugging, and deployment.
领英推荐
Step 5: Testing
After the software has been developed, it must be thoroughly tested to ensure that it meets the requirements and functions as intended. Testing typically involves a combination of manual and automated testing methods, and may involve multiple rounds of testing to ensure that any issues are identified and resolved.
Step 6: Deployment
Once the software has been fully tested and any issues have been resolved, it is ready for deployment. This involves releasing the software to the target audience, and ensuring that it is properly installed and configured on their systems. Deployment typically involves several stages, including installation, configuration, and user training.
Step 7: Maintenance and Support
Once the software has been deployed, it must be maintained and supported to ensure that it continues to function as intended. This involves monitoring the software for issues, providing user support, and updating the software as necessary to address any bugs or security issues that arise.
In conclusion, the transformation of ideas into software involves a number of complex and interrelated steps. From ideation and requirements gathering, to design, development, testing, deployment, and maintenance and support, each step is critical to the success of the project. By carefully managing each step of the process, and leveraging the right tools and resources, it is possible to turn even the most complex ideas into successful software applications.
RG Infosys is a software development company that specializes in transforming ideas into successful software applications. With a team of experienced developers and project managers, RG Infosys can help you navigate each step of the software development process, from ideation to deployment and beyond.
One of the key ways that RG Infosys can help you achieve your software development goals is through their expertise in requirements gathering. Their team has extensive experience working with clients to define the specific features and functionality that their software applications require in order to be successful. By leveraging their expertise in this area, RG Infosys can help ensure that your software application meets the needs of your target audience and solves the problem you set out to address.
In addition to their expertise in requirements gathering, RG Infosys also excels in software design and development. Their team has experience working with a wide range of programming languages and development platforms, and can help you select the best tools and technologies for your project. With a focus on usability, scalability, and security, RG Infosys can help you build a software application that is not only functional but also highly effective.
Finally, RG Infosys can help you with software deployment, maintenance, and support. Their team can work with you to ensure that your software is properly installed and configured, and provide ongoing support to ensure that it continues to function as intended. With a focus on user satisfaction and long-term success, RG Infosys is dedicated to helping you achieve your software development goals.
In conclusion, if you are looking to transform your idea into a successful software application, RG Infosys can help. With their expertise in requirements gathering, software design and development, and deployment and support, they have the tools and resources to help you achieve your goals. So why not get in touch with them today and see how they can help you bring your idea to life?